You shouldn't be losing waves when growing your hair out if your still brushing while doing it. Maybe the waves you have are not fully developed yet.
A few suggestions.
1. Brush more.
2. If you using a soft brush then switch to a medium or hard brush.
3. Du-rag your hair longer
4. Or just geta haircut.
